Find centralized, trusted content and collaborate around the technologies you use most.
Teams
Q&A for work
Connect and share knowledge within a single location that is structured and easy to search.
可能重复: 我可以从完整的 mysql mysqldump 文件恢复单个表吗?
任何人都知道您是否可以从完整的 MySQL 转储中导入特定表?我的客户要求他的数据库每小时转储一次,我们保留过去 3 天左右的 SQL 每小时备份以防万一。
编辑:在 Windows 服务器上运行的 MySQL
也许只备份/转储特定表会更容易?
我用这个: http ://www.dwalker.co.uk/phpmysqlautobackup/
强烈推荐 :) - 您可以传入要导出的特定表数组。
我猜如果整个系统出现故障,您正在转储整个数据库以进行恢复,因此您希望继续这样做。
但是,在您转储整个数据库之后,也不需要花费太多额外的时间来转储单个文件。只需编写第二个 mysqldump 命令的形式
mysqldump -u xxx -pxxx database_name table_name > database.table.yyyymmdd.sql
并且您可以在需要时将表格单独保存在文件中。